SRH vs DC: ₹23 Crore Star Heinrich Klaasen Emerges as Biggest Threat to Delhi Capitals

The 31st match of the Indian Premier League 2026 between Sunrisers Hyderabad and Delhi Capitals promises to be a closely contested encounter, especially considering their evenly matched record in Hyderabad. Out of seven matches played at this venue, both teams have won three each, with one ending without a result. However, this time, a key player in Sunrisers Hyderabad’s lineup could tilt the balance.

While much of the opposition’s strategy usually revolves around containing Abhishek Sharma, the real danger for Delhi Capitals lies elsewhere. The spotlight is firmly on Heinrich Klaasen, the explosive wicketkeeper-batter who was retained by SRH for a massive ₹23 crore. Klaasen has been in exceptional form in IPL 2026, scoring 283 runs in six innings with three half-centuries, and currently sits among the top run-scorers of the season.

What makes Klaasen particularly dangerous is not just his current form but his dominant record against Delhi’s bowling attack. His strike rate against Lungi Ngidi stands at an astonishing 243, while he scores at 192 against Kuldeep Yadav and 180 against Axar Patel. Notably, Ngidi and Kuldeep have never dismissed him in the IPL, and Axar has managed to get him out only once in ten innings. Adding to Delhi’s concerns, Klaasen has not been dismissed by any spinner in IPL 2026 so far, which further reduces the effectiveness of their spin attack.

In contrast, Delhi Capitals have had better control over Abhishek Sharma. Captain Axar Patel has dismissed him twice in limited deliveries, restricting his scoring rate significantly. This makes Klaasen the primary threat going into the match, and how Delhi handles him could very well decide the outcome of this crucial clash.
